Japanese motorcycle manufacturer Kawasaki is reportedly working on a 600cc supercharged sports bike christened as R2. The R2 will be smaller and user friendly younger sibling of the H2R motorcycle.

A set of leaked patent images indicates the design of the R2 will sport a blend of ZX-6R and the H2R. The motorcycle will feature a large air scoop below the visor with a compact nose kind of embellishment ahead of the headlights. An air intake tucked under the belly of the fuel tank and an under seat exhaust can be seen that will make the side profile sleek. The fuel tank has been extended under the rider's seat to make more room for the supercharger unit. The motorcycle will use trellis frame.

There is no information on the power and torque figures as of now. However the number will certainly raise eyebrows just the way Kawasaki did when it showcased the H2R with 310bhp and H2 with 200bhp.

Kawasaki has already trademarked the Ninja R2 name in Europe and that concretes new nomenclature for company's supercharged motorcycle. The R2 is expected to debut at the EICMA show in Milan in November.
